PhD title: Documentary Film and Observational Cinema in Sardinia: A Visual Anthropology
Supervisor: Dr Clodagh Brook
I was educated in Italy, where I graduated cum laude in Philosophy. I am currently working on ethnographic films and documentaries in Sardinia – my native island. I am interested in Film Studies, Italian Studies, and History of Ideas, but my intellectual direction is Visual Anthropology.
Activities
I write scholarly articles on documentary and ethnographic cinema, and have published in leading journals in the fields of Visual Anthropology and Italian Studies – e.g. Visual Anthropology, Visual Anthropology Review, and Modern Italy.
I have acted as peer reviewer for Visual Anthropology and attended the 12th RAI International Festival of Ethnographic Film held in London, 23-26 June 2011.
I am a member of EASA (European Association of Social Anthropologists).
I’ve been admitted to the Video Workshop 2012 taught by David and Judith MacDougall from 7-13 September, and invited as a guest to the SIEFF festival to follow from 15-23 September.
